Scope of Work and Objectives
The overarching objective of this tender is to secure the supply of the following automotive components:
- Hand Brake Cable
- Fuel Filter Assembly (Petrol)
- Spider Bearing
- Wiper Assembly Blade
- Air Filter Assembly
- Fuel Filter Cartridge
- Brake Bisc Pad
- Brake Pad Assembly
Interested vendors must demonstrate their capability to supply these components in the stipulated quantities while adhering to relevant specifications and quality standards. This procurement aims to enhance the logistics and operational efficiency of the armed forces.
